“Barbara”
5 Rounds For Time:
20 Pull-Ups
30 Push-Ups
40 Sit-Ups
50 Air Squats
3 Minute REST
***Instead of Push-Ups, you can substitute these for Dumbbell Snatches or with a clever rowing movement setup. This setup took me awhile get the right height because I wanted to use items you most likely have at home instead of stacking piles of wood. I used a thick handled shovel (You could use fencing pipe or industrial pipe from any hardware store too. 4 or 5 feet would only cost about $15), styrofoam blocks, and cardboard to make where the shovel handle lays on a little more sturdy. I don’t recommend just using just Styrofoam as I could see that the handle would probably eventually bite through it. And one more thing… use carpet or a rubber mat to put your feet on. Using the tile was slippery!
***This is a high volume workout! So, you can also modify this by doing 3 or 4 Rounds. Stay within your capabilities but try to aim towards the intentional stimulus… which is a bit grueling, longer duration, and challenging volume.
